1. Exploring Romeโs Timeless Charm on Foot
Rome is one giant open-air museum, and the best part? Most of it can be experienced for free.
Free Attractions Every Couple Should See
Start your day with a stroll around the Colosseum and Roman Forum. Even without paying for entry, the views are breathtaking. Wander through Piazza Navona, toss a coin into the Trevi Fountain, and climb the Spanish Steps hand in hand.
Best Cheap Eats in Rome
Skip expensive restaurants and dive into Roman street food. Pizza al taglio (pizza by the slice) and supplรฌ (fried rice balls) make perfect snacks for a budget date. For foodie couples, check out food & wine love in Italy.
2. Venice on a Budget: Gondolas, Canals & Hidden Corners
Venice may be synonymous with luxury, but couples can still enjoy its magic without splurging.
Affordable Alternatives to Gondola Rides
Instead of a pricey gondola, take a traghettoโa gondola-style ferry that costs just a couple of euros. Itโs short, sweet, and romantic without breaking the bank.
Romantic Walks Through Hidden Alleys
Get lost in Veniceโs maze-like streets. Crossing tiny bridges, discovering hidden squares, and watching reflections dance on the canals are free but unforgettable.
3. Florence: Art, Culture, and Budget-Friendly Romance
Florence is a dream for art-loving couples, and much of its beauty can be enjoyed for free.
Free Museums and Art Spots
Visit churches like Santa Maria Novella or explore outdoor sculptures in Piazza della Signoria. On the first Sunday of every month, many museums offer free entry.
Sunset Views from Piazzale Michelangelo
One of the most romantic (and free!) experiences in Florence is watching the sun set behind the Duomo and Ponte Vecchio from Piazzale Michelangelo.

5. Amalfi Coast Magic Without the Luxury Price Tag
The Amalfi Coast is famous for luxury resorts, but couples can enjoy its beauty affordably.
Hiking Trails with Million-Dollar Views
Walk the Path of the Gods (Sentiero degli Dei). The views are spectacular, and the trail is completely free.
Affordable Seaside Villages for Couples
Instead of staying in pricey Positano, base yourselves in budget-friendly villages like Minori or Praiano. For more inspiration, check out Italian coastal escapes.
6. Cinque Terre: Coastal Romance for Less
Cinque Terre is breathtaking, and it doesnโt have to be expensive if you plan smartly.
Budget Train Pass for Couples
Buy a Cinque Terre Train Card for unlimited rides between the five villages. Itโs cost-effective and perfect for exploring together.
Couplesโ Walk on the Via dellโAmore
This cliffside โLoversโ Laneโ is one of the most romantic walks in Italy, and itโs budget-friendly too.

8. Sicily: Romantic Island Vibes on a Budget
Sicily blends history, beaches, and delicious foodโall without the mainlandโs high prices.
Street Food Adventures for Two
Couples can feast on arancini, panelle, and cannoli from Palermoโs bustling street food markets for just a few euros.
Exploring Ancient Ruins Without Expensive Tours
Visit temples in Agrigento or Roman mosaics in Piazza Armerinaโmany sites are free or have low-cost entry.
9. Hot Springs in Tuscany for Couples
For couples seeking wellness and relaxation, Tuscany offers natural hot springs.
Free Natural Thermal Baths
Saturniaโs outdoor thermal pools are free and open year-round. Imagine soaking under the stars together without spending a cent.
Affordable Wellness Retreats
For couples who prefer a spa experience, smaller local wellness centers often have budget-friendly packages. Learn more on wellness escapes.

Tips for Couples Traveling Italy on a Budget
Save Money on Accommodation
Consider staying in guesthouses, B&Bs, or agriturismos (farm stays). Theyโre cheaper and often more romantic than chain hotels.
Timing Your Trip for Cheaper Experiences
Travel during the shoulder seasons (spring or fall). Prices drop, crowds are fewer, and the weather is still gorgeous.
